About Amparo Macías

Amparo Macías is a scholar working on Molecular Biology, Immunology, Oncology, Radiology, Nuclear Medicine and Imaging and Biotechnology, having authored 15 papers that have together received 437 indexed citations. Recurring topics across this work include Glycosylation and Glycoproteins Research (8 papers), Immunotherapy and Immune Responses (7 papers), Cancer Research and Treatments (4 papers), Monoclonal and Polyclonal Antibodies Research (4 papers), Lung Cancer Research Studies (3 papers), Peptidase Inhibition and Analysis (2 papers), Galectins and Cancer Biology (1 paper) and Cancer Genomics and Diagnostics (1 paper). The work is most often cited by research in Immunology (171 citations), Radiology, Nuclear Medicine and Imaging (164 citations), Oncology (190 citations), Cancer Research (46 citations) and Molecular Biology (208 citations). Amparo Macías has collaborated with scholars based in Cuba, Argentina and Spain. Frequent co-authors include Rolando Pérez, Agustín Lage, Ana María Vázquez, Ana Hernández, Eduardo Suárez, Victor Gustavo Balera Brito, Daniel F. Alonso, Daniel E. Gómez, Marta Ayala and M J Coloma. Their work appears in journals such as Journal of Clinical Oncology, Frontiers in Oncology, The Journal of Immunology, Breast Cancer Research and Treatment and Human Vaccines.
